intelbras vulnerabilities and exploits
(subscribe to this query)
8.8
CVSSv3
CVE-2021-32402
Intelbras Router RF 301K Firmware 1.1.2 is vulnerable to Cross Site Request Forgery (CSRF) due to lack of validation and insecure configurations in inputs and modules.

CVE-2022-24654
Authenticated stored c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in "Field Server Address" field in INTELBRAS ATA 200 Firmware 74.19.10.21 allows malicious users to inject JavaScript code through a crafted payload.

CVE-2023-36144
An authentication bypass in Intelbras Switch SG 2404 MR in firmware 1.00.54 allows an unauthenticated malicious user to download the backup file of the device, exposing critical information about the device configuration.

CVE-2019-11415
An issue exists on Intelbras IWR 3000N 1.5.0 devices. A malformed login request allows remote malicious users to cause a denial of service (reboot), as demonstrated by JSON misparsing of the \""} string to v1/system/login.

CVE-2018-12455
Intelbras NPLUG 1.0.0.14 wireless repeater devices have a critical vulnerability that allows an malicious user to authenticate in the web interface just by using "admin:" as the name of a cookie.

CVE-2018-12456
Intelbras NPLUG 1.0.0.14 wireless repeater devices have no CSRF token protection in the web interface, allowing malicious users to perform actions such as changing the wireless SSID, rebooting the device, editing access control lists, or activating remote access.

CVE-2017-14942
Intelbras WRN 150 devices allow remote malicious users to read the configuration file, and consequently bypass authentication, via a direct request for cgi-bin/DownloadCfg/RouterCfm.cfg containing an admin:language=pt cookie.
